Through the community garden, we aim to foster kindness, connection, and a shared sense of purpose,
while educating local children about healthy eating habits.
Simultaneously, our team is dedicated to establishing Monarch butterfly habitats by planting milkweed. Western Monarch populations face severe threats from habitat loss, pesticide use, and climate change, which has led to a dramatic decline. These threats include the loss of milkweed, destruction of overwintering trees, and extreme weather events.
